TAMPA, Fla. -- Tampa Bay Buccaneers quarterback Jameis Winston became emotional when asked on Thursday how difficult it was to sit out Week 1 of the regular season because of Hurricane Irma.
He paused for several seconds, his eyes growing big. He looked up at the ceiling and shook his head.
"I went through a tough time watching," said the 23-year-old Winston, whom his teammates and coaches have always referred to as the ultimate football junkie and one of the fiercest competitors they've ever come across.
But this wasn't about football. He was having a tough time watching the news reports, seeing Hurricane Irma ravage the state of Florida.
